After a shock loss in round one against Slovakia, Germany have bounced back strongly with three successive victories to put them top of their group. Luxembourg’s form has been a stark contrast, and they are still yet to register a point on the board. After four matches, they have scored just the single goal, while their heaviest defeat was dealt in Germany.

Julian Nagelsmann’s men were dominant from the outset, taking the lead after just 12 minutes following a disallowed goal four minutes in. Luxembourg defender Dirk Carlson was sent off soon after for handling the ball in his own penalty area, but the Germans were well in control even before that red card.

With the extra man advantage, Germany dominated proceedings on home turf, registering 84% possession from which they carved out 31 shots. In return, the visitors managed just one shot, in what was a tough away outing.

📈 Luxembourg v Germany Form & Stats

That unwanted, losing feeling has been a familiar one for Luxembourg in the group stages so far, as they have failed to score in any of their last three fixtures. The October international break was a particularly damning one for them, as they suffered back-to-back defeats against Slovakia and Germany.

On Thursday night, Slovakia host Northern Ireland in Kosice, and will be favourites along with Germany to secure victory in round five. If results go as expected, a round six clash between Germany and Slovakia at the Red Bull Arena will decide the group. The winner secures automatic World Cup qualification, while the loser will hope to secure qualification via the playoffs.

Germany were beaten by Slovakia in round one of the group stages, but they will fancy their chances of enacting revenge on home turf, especially given how strong they have looked since that result.

Die Mannschaft have won their last three matches coming into this Friday night clash, having conceded just one goal in that time. They kept two clean sheets in their October fixtures, while scoring five goals in return.
